Introduction to UPVC
UPVC is a rigid type of polyvinyl chloride (PVC) that is free from plasticizers, that makes it more durable and resistant to environmental aspects such as heat, cold, and wetness. Established in the early 20th century, UPVC has progressed to become a favored product in numerous building and construction applications due to its exceptional residential or commercial properties.
Advantages of UPVC Doors and Windows
Resilience and Longevity
- Resistant to Weathering: UPVC is extremely resistant to severe weather, consisting of UV radiation, wetness, and temperature level variations. This makes it ideal for both tropical and temperate climates.
- Strong and Sturdy: The material is robust and does not warp, fracture, or rot, guaranteeing that the doors and windows maintain their integrity in time.
- Low Maintenance: Unlike wood, which needs routine painting and treatments, UPVC doors and windows are easy to tidy and preserve, frequently needing just a wipe with a damp fabric.
Energy Efficiency
- Insulation: UPVC has outstanding insulating residential or commercial properties, assisting to keep homes warm in winter and cool in summertime. This can cause substantial energy cost savings and decreased energy bills.
- Sealing: The tight seals supplied by UPVC frames avoid air leak, further improving energy performance and minimizing the load on heating and cooling systems.
Cost-Effectiveness
- Budget friendly: UPVC doors and windows are normally more cost-effective than their wood or aluminum equivalents. The initial investment is lower, and the long-lasting upkeep expenses are minimal.
- Long-Term Savings: The energy effectiveness of UPVC can result in long-term savings on cooling and heating costs, making it a wise choice for budget-conscious house owners.
Security and Safety
- Multi-Point Locking Systems: Many UPVC windows and doors included multi-point locking systems, which supply boosted security against break-ins.
- Burglar-Resistant: The robust building and reinforced frames make it difficult for intruders to require entry.
- Fire Resistance: UPVC is naturally resistant to fire and does not contribute to the spread of flames, making it a much safer alternative for home building.
Visual Appeal
- Modern and Stylish: UPVC windows and doors are readily available in a range of colors and styles, making them ideal for both modern and standard looks.
- Personalized: Homeowners can select from various surfaces, such as brushed, matte, or shiny, to match their interior and outside design choices.
Ecological Impact
- Recyclable: UPVC can be recycled, reducing waste and the ecological footprint associated with building and remodelling.
- Sustainable: While issues have been raised about the production of PVC, improvements in manufacturing procedures have considerably decreased the ecological effect, making UPVC a more sustainable choice.
Installation Process
The installation of UPVC doors and windows is a straightforward process that can be finished by professional installers. Here is a detailed guide:
Measurement and Planning
- Accurate Measurements: Take precise measurements of the door and window openings to ensure a perfect fit.
- Style Selection: Choose the style, color, and surface that finest fit the home's architecture and the house owner's preferences.
Preparation
- Remove Old Units: Carefully get rid of existing doors and windows, guaranteeing that the surrounding walls and frames are not damaged.
- Inspect Openings: Check the openings for any indications of wet, rot, or structural damage. Address these problems before continuing.
Fitting the New Units
- Install Frame: Place the UPVC frame into the opening and secure it with screws or nails. Ensure that the frame is level and plumb.
- Use Sealant: Use a premium sealant to fill any gaps in between the frame and the wall, guaranteeing a tight seal.
- Install Glass: Insert the glass panes into the frames and protect them with glazing beads or rubber gaskets.
Completing Touches
- Install Hardware: Attach hinges, deals with, and locks to the doors and windows, ensuring they operate smoothly.
- Final Inspection: Check all units for appropriate function and look, making any needed adjustments.
Common FAQs
Are UPVC doors and windows ideal for all climates?
- Answer: Yes, UPVC windows doors upvc and doors are created to withstand a wide variety of environments. They are resistant to UV radiation, wetness, and temperature fluctuations, making them ideal for both tropical and temperate areas.
How do UPVC doors and windows compare in regards to energy performance?
- Response: UPVC doors and windows are highly energy-efficient due to their outstanding insulating properties and tight seals. They can help decrease heat loss in the winter and heat gain in the summertime, causing lower energy intake and energy bills.
Are UPVC windows and doors protect?
- Answer: UPVC doors and windows are really secure, especially when geared up with multi-point locking systems. The robust building and construction and enhanced frames make them resistant to forced entry and burglaries.
Do UPVC windows and doors require regular upkeep?
- Response: UPVC windows and doors require minimal upkeep. Routine cleansing with a moist cloth and periodic lubrication of moving parts are usually adequate to keep them in good condition.
Can UPVC doors and windows be customized?
- Response: Yes, UPVC doors and windows use a variety of modification choices. Homeowners can select from different colors, finishes, and styles to match their style preferences and the total aesthetic of their home.
What is the lifespan of UPVC doors and windows?
- Response: With proper setup and maintenance, UPVC windows and doors can last for 30 to 50 years. The material's durability and resistance to environmental elements add to its durability.
Are UPVC doors and windows eco-friendly?
- Response: While the production of u pvc doors and windows has environmental ramifications, UPVC is recyclable and contemporary production processes have actually reduced its environmental effect. Additionally, the energy performance of UPVC can lead to lower carbon emissions over the long term.
Benefits Over Traditional Materials
Comparison with Wooden Doors and Windows
- Durability: UPVC is more durable and resistant to rot, warp, and decay compared to wood.
- Upkeep: Wood needs regular painting and treatments to keep its appearance and stability, whereas UPVC is low maintenance.
- Cost: UPVC is typically more affordable and provides better long-term worth due to its durability and energy performance.
Comparison with Aluminum Doors and Windows

- Insulation: UPVC provides better insulation than aluminum, which can conduct heat and cold.
- Weight: UPVC is lighter than aluminum, making it simpler to set up and handle.
- Appearance: UPVC provides a larger series of customization choices, consisting of colors and surfaces, compared to aluminum.
